The most obvious benefit of reading aloud to preschoolers is an academic one. Children who are read to develop a love of learning and often grasp reading concepts at a younger age than those who are not. They become familiar with the format of books, the printed text, and more complex vocabulary, which will be beneficial as they begin to piece together their first sounds and words. Research has shown that children that are early readers are more successful in school than later readers.

Among other things reading aloud to preschoolers can help in their language development, speech skills, and communication skills. Oftentimes a book can present a complex theme to children in a way they can understand it. As we discuss these concepts with our children they will be able to understand the world around them, but more importantly verbalize and discuss it.

Another benefit of reading aloud to preschoolers is the mental boost that it gives to the child himself. A child that is read to from a young age often develops a high self-esteem and a curiosity about life. These skills will benefit the child not only in reading but in life. The bonding that takes place between parent and child while reading a book is priceless. The one on one time spent sharing a story together can make a child feel supported, loved, and safe. An environment fostering these feelings is priceless in the life of a little preschooler.

As we have time with preschoolers before they enter the world of elementary school, the time spent preparing them for reading readiness is priceless. The benefits are numerous and the results vast and critical. When we read aloud to our preschoolers we not only strengthen our relationship with them, we give them tools to help them prepare for a successful life.
